Public bug reported:

When running a system with more than 1 sound device (in my case the on-
board-sound and some Logitech USB Speakers) gdm crashs or jams pulse
sound server, when "Login Successful" sound is enabled.  So that no
system sounds can be played and so on.

This situation doesn't change even if  "Login Successful" is disabled and the 
System is rebooted.
The Problem also can't be solved by setting the correct device as default with 
“asoundconf set-default-card CARD”. 

The only way to solve this is to deactivate the "Login Successful"
sound, deactivate/remove  the unused sound device and reboot the system.

Ubuntu 9.04

gdm:
  Installed: 2.20.10-0ubuntu2
  Candidate: 2.20.10-0ubuntu2
  Version table:
 *** 2.20.10-0ubuntu2 0
        500 http://ch.archive.ubuntu.com jaunty/main Packages
        100 /var/lib/dpkg/status
